Admiral (retired) Ernest Neville Rolfe, C.B., R.N. (11 August, 1847 – 11 May, 1909) was an officer of the Royal Navy.

Early Life & Career

In accordance with the provisions of the Order in Council of 5 February, 1872, Rolfe was promoted to the rank of Lieutenant with seniority of 29 December, 1871.[1]

Rolfe was promoted to the rank of Commander from the Victoria and Albert with seniority of 30 August, 1879.[2]

He was appointed in command of the battleship Repulse in October, 1895.[3]

Rolfe was promoted to the rank of Rear-Admiral on 13 January, 1899, vice Cardale.[4]

He was promoted to the rank of Vice-Admiral on 1 October, 1903, vice Drummond.[5] In accordance with the provisions of the Order in Council of 8 December, he was placed on the Retired List, at his own request, on 8 December.[6]

Rolfe was advanced to the rank of Admiral on the Retired List on 10 October, 1907.[7]
